Oncology Services Director jobs in Canton, MI

Oncology Services Director plans and directs all aspects of an organization's oncology services policies, standards, and programs. Responsible for strategic clinical relationships with physicians and interns. Being an Oncology Services Director ensures oncology clinical programs are in compliance with all applicable regulations. Researches and studies current medical publications and data on new treatments and practices to ensure high quality clinical service offerings. Additionally, Oncology Services Director advises non-medical management on clinical and patient related matters and policies. Requires a MD. Typically reports to top management. The Oncology Services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. To be an Oncology Services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function.   • POSITION TITLE:

    Director of Children’s Services

    REPORTS TO:

    Chief Operating Officer

    SUPERVISES:

    PAT Parent Educators, Fatherhood Coordinator, Belleville Data Entry, Ypsilanti Parenting Network Coordinator, student interns, work-study students, and volunteers

    FLSA STATUS:

    Exempt (Professional)

    POSITION PURPOSE:

    Coordinate, manage, develop, and evaluate all aspects of SOS programs and services for children and school age youth and their families. Facilitate children’s programs, including special events and seasonal programs. Provide intervention services including assessment, referral, and coordination of activities for families experiencing homelessness. Serve as Parents as Teachers Supervisor using the Parents as Teachers model for families with children age 0 to 5.

    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

    I. Children Services Program Management Responsibilities:

    1. Coordinate, manage, develop, and evaluate all aspects of programs and services for children and school age youth and their families.

    2. Build collaborative relationships within the community related to children and youth programming to determine gaps in services and addressing those gaps.

    3. Actively build partnerships with other youth-serving organizations in order to avoid duplication of service and maximize resources for families.

    4. Provide regular supervision and evaluation of children’s program staff, interns, work study students, and volunteers.

    5. Assure that all children’s staff, student interns, and volunteers receive appropriate orientation and training specific to their program area.

    6. Assist in designing and implementing program outcomes evaluation.

    7. Assure that all record keeping and grant-related reporting is completed in a timely fashion.

    8. Serve as agency liaison to local schools, establishing ongoing relationships with teachers and other appropriate school personnel to coordinate services for school-aged youth in the program.

    9. Serve as agency liaison to Washtenaw Area Alliance for Children and Youth (WACY) and Great Start Collaborative (Success by Six); attend meetings.

    10. Assure that all children’s programs are age appropriate and culturally sensitive.

    11. Participate in appropriate inter-agency program planning for children’s services.

    12. Assist in advocating for homeless children with community systems impacting their lives

    13. Develop and maintain knowledge of community organizations, counseling agencies, programs and other community referral resources providing services for children and youth

    14. Ensure the timely and satisfactory completion and submission of outcomes reporting for all children’s funders and programs.

    15. Actively participate in statewide coordinating groups relevant to early childhood programming.

    16. Other duties as assigned by the Chief Operating Officer

    II. Parents As Teachers Program Responsibilities:

    17. Acquire/maintain training and certification in the Parents as Teachers model of home visiting

    18. Using the Parents as Teachers (PAT) model, conduct regular Reflective Supervision with all PAT certified staff

    19. Ensure that all PAT staff complete appropriate certification trainings and maintain ongoing certification

    20. Ensure that PAT staff are conducting quarterly Ages and Stages Questionnaire (ASQ) screenings on all eligible children in the household, make appropriate referrals as needed.

    21. Ensure that PAT staff are completing an annual PAT Health Record to monitor child’s overall physical health.

    22. Oversee data collection records in Visit Tracker in accordance with agency and funding source requirements.

    23. Oversee Group Connection parenting workshops as required by PAT curriculum.

    24. Oversee parenting groups and play groups for families of children age 0-5 as appropriate.

    AGENCY RESPONSIBILITIES:

    1. Actively support the SOS commitment to diversity in all areas and responsibilities.

    2. Uphold and ensure appropriate enforcement of all agency policies and practices.

    3. Participate in community relations and outreach tasks as directed and required.

    4. Serve as a member of the Management Team, and attend Management Team Meetings.

    BASIC QUALIFICATIONS:

    Masters Degree in Social Work, Psychology or another Human Services field Preferred; or Bachelor’s Degree plus 4 years post BA experience required. Knowledge and demonstrated skills in working with economically distressed populations as well as sensitivity to the special needs of minorities, women, and low-income populations.

    Knowledge and experience working in the areas of group counseling, parenting education and support, substance abuse, and direct service to children a must. Direct experience working with children and parents in a human services setting required. Successful supervisory experience required. Knowledge of area children’s services providers, school personnel and system of care agencies preferred.

    Good writing, verbal skills, and Working knowledge of Word, Excel, and Google communication platforms required. Possession of Michigan Driver’s License in good standing that meets agency insurance standards and a willingness to obtain a Michigan Chauffeur’s License. Consistent access to reliable transportation. Maintain compliance with the Substance Free Work Place Act, the Privacy Act and Federal, State, and local laws regarding professional standards of conduct.

Canton, officially the Charter Township of Canton, is a charter township of Wayne County in the U.S. state of Michigan. It is located about 8 miles (13 km) west of the city limits of Detroit and 8 miles (13 km) east of the city limits of Ann Arbor. As of the 2010 census, the township had a population of 90,173, making it Michigan's second largest township and eleventh largest community. Canton is ranked as 96th highest-income place in the United States with a population of 50,000 or more.
